References
  1. 1.0 1.1 Concord, Middlesex, Massachusetts, United States. Births, Marriages, and Deaths, 1635-1850. (Boston: Beacon Press, 1891)
    p. 432.

    The Burying Grounds
    Joseph Brooks, in the 76th year of his age, July 11, 1746.
    [Age 75, so born about 1671.]

  2. Potter, Charles Edward. Genealogies of some old families of Concord, Massachusetts: and their descendants in part to the present generation. (Bowie, Maryland: Heritage Books, 1995)
    p. 7.

    Children of Joshua Brooks and Hannah Mason: Joseph, b. Concord 1681, d. 17 Sep 1759 [sic, inspection of the probate files of Joseph d. 1746 and Joseph d. 1759 is sufficient to know Rebecca's husband d. 1746, and based on the age attached, was born about 1971, no 1681], m. 26 Jun 1704 Rebecca Blodget.

  3. Middlesex, Massachusetts, United States. Middlesex County, MA: Probate File Papers, 1648-1871. (American Ancestors, 2014)
    Case 2857: Joseph Brooks 1746h Brooks 1759.

    Will of "Joseph Brooks of Concord", dated 24 May 1746, proved 21 Jul 1746, names wife Rebecca Brooks [lands heretofore given to son James Brooks], son Joseph Brooks, daughter Rebecca Baker; residue divided equally between children namely Joseph Brooks, Nathan Brooks, Amos Brooks, Jonas Brooks, Isaac Brooks, James Brooks, Mara Russell & Hannah Russell & Rebecca Baker. Son Jonas Brooks to be executor.
    14 Jul 1746: Assent of Rebecah Brooks widow of said Decased to will of husband. Petition of Thomas Baker husband of Rebecah, Nathan Brooks, Amos Brooks, Jonas Brooks, Isaac Brooks, James Brooks, Hannah Russell, Jon[a]thon Russell approving widow's legacies.
    14 Jul 1746: Receipt of Nath'll Russell of Littleton on behalf of wife Mara. Assent of Thomas Baker as attorney to Joseph Brooks. Thomas Baker husband to Rebecah. Also Hannah Russell, Nathan Brooks, Isaac Brooks, Jonathan Russell, James Brooks, Amos Brooks. Quitclaim of Nath'll Russell of Littleton and Mara his wife giving household goods to widow.
    20 Aug 1746: Inventory of estate of Mr Joseph Brooks late of Concord.
    30 Mar 1747: Account of Jonas Brook allowed.
